Park Electrochemical Corp. Announces Asia Pacific Director of Product Sales

LAKE SUCCESS, New York, August 17, 2004….Park Electrochemical Corp. (NYSE – PKE) today announced the promotion of Freddy Lee to Asia Pacific Director of Product Sales. Mr. Lee will be responsible for the marketing and sales of Park/Nelco’s complete advanced substrate materials product line in the Asia Pacific region. He will report to Emily Groehl, Senior Vice President, Marketing and Sales, of Park Electrochemical Corp.

Freddy Lee joined Park Electrochemical Corp. in January 1999 as Sales and Customer Service Director and was responsible for regional management of the Asia Pacific region for China, Taiwan and Japan. Most recently, he served as Director of Advanced Product Marketing for the Asia Pacific region. Prior to joining Park, Mr. Lee had over 15 years of marketing and sales experience in the electronics industry. He had served as Business Development Manager for an original equipment manufacturer and manufacturing service company in China, Advanced Engineering Manager of Hybrid Microelectronics for CTS Singapore and Semiconductor Packaging Engineer for Coors Ceramics Singapore and Texas Instruments Singapore.

Mr. Lee received a Masters of Business Administration degree from the University of East London.

Park Electrochemical Corp. is a leading global designer and producer of electronic materials used to fabricate complex multilayer printed circuit boards and interconnection systems. Park specializes in advanced materials for high layer count circuit boards and high-speed digital and RF/Microwave electronic systems. Park also designs and manufactures advanced composite materials for the aerospace, military and industrial markets. The Company’s manufacturing facilities are located in Singapore, China, France, Connecticut, New York, Arizona and California.
